Blackbaud Announces 2019 Second Quarter Results

CHARLESTON, S.C., July 30, 2019 /PRNewswire/ -- Blackbaud (NASDAQ: BLKB), the world's leading cloud software company powering social good, today announced financial results for its second quarter ended June 30, 2019.

"This year marks our 15th year as a Nasdaq listed public company, which is a testament to the incredible team we have and their dedication to drive powerful social impact and create shareholder value," said Mike Gianoni, Blackbaud's president and CEO. "We continued to drive market-specific innovation across our vertical markets. Soon we will be announcing general availability of Blackbaud Church Management, part of the Cloud Solution for Faith Communities, and we continue to see strong market traction with our new Education Management portfolio, part of the Cloud Solution for Higher Education."

Second Quarter 2019 Results Compared to Second Quarter 2018 Results:

  • Total GAAP revenue was $225.6 million, up 5.6%, with $208.5 million in GAAP recurring revenue, representing 92.4% of total GAAP revenue. GAAP recurring revenue was up 8.2%.
  • Total non-GAAP revenue was $226.4 million, up 5.5%, with $209.2 million in non-GAAP recurring revenue, representing 92.4% of total non-GAAP revenue. Non-GAAP recurring revenue was up 8.0%.
  • Non-GAAP organic recurring revenue increased 5.0%.
  • GAAP income from operations was $13.5 million, with GAAP operating margin of 6.0%, an increase of 70 basis points.
  • Non-GAAP income from operations was $43.5 million, with non-GAAP operating margin of 19.2%, a decrease of 190 basis points.
  • GAAP net income was $7.1 million, with GAAP diluted earnings per share of $0.15, up $0.01.
  • Non-GAAP net income was $31.9 million, with non-GAAP diluted earnings per share of $0.66, down $0.03.
  • Non-GAAP free cash flow was $38.0 million, a decrease of $3.6 million.

Dividend
Blackbaud announced today that its Board of Directors has declared a third quarter 2019 dividend of $0.12 per share payable on September 13, 2019 to stockholders of record on August 28, 2019.

Financial Outlook
Blackbaud today reaffirmed its 2019 full year financial guidance:

  • Non-GAAP revenue of $880 million to $910 million
  • Non-GAAP operating margin of 16.7% to 17.2%
  • Non-GAAP diluted earnings per share of $2.11 to $2.28
  • Non-GAAP free cash flow of $124 million to $134 million

Adoption of New Lease Accounting Standard
On January 1, 2019, we adopted Financial Accounting Standards Board ("FASB") Accounting Standards Update ("ASU") 2016-02, Leases (Topic 842) ("ASU 2016-02"), using the transition method that allowed us to initially apply the guidance at the adoption date of January 1, 2019 without adjusting comparative periods presented. ASU 2016-02 requires lessees to record most leases on their balance sheet but recognize expenses in the income statement in a manner similar to previous guidance. The impacts of adoption are reflected in Blackbaud's guidance and the other financial information herein. Non-GAAP Financial Measures
Blackbaud has provided in this release financial information that has not been prepared in accordance with GAAP. This information includes non-GAAP revenue, non-GAAP recurring revenue, non-GAAP gross profit, non-GAAP gross margin, non-GAAP income from operations, non-GAAP operating margin, non-GAAP net income and non-GAAP diluted earnings per share. Blackbaud has acquired businesses whose net tangible assets include deferred revenue. In accordance with GAAP reporting requirements, Blackbaud recorded write-downs of deferred revenue to fair value, which resulted in lower recognized revenue. Both on a quarterly and year-to-date basis, the revenue for the acquired businesses is deferred and typically recognized over a one-year period, so Blackbaud's GAAP revenues for the one-year period after the acquisitions will not reflect the full amount of revenues that would have been reported if the acquired deferred revenue was not written down to fair value. The non-GAAP measures described above reverse the acquisition-related deferred revenue write-downs so that the full amount of revenue booked by the acquired companies is included, which Blackbaud believes provides a more accurate representation of a revenue run-rate in a given period. In addition to reversing write-downs of acquisition-related deferred revenue, non-GAAP financial measures discussed above exclude the impact of certain items that Blackbaud believes are not directly related to its performance in any particular period, but are for its long-term benefit over multiple periods.

In addition, Blackbaud uses non-GAAP organic revenue growth, non-GAAP organic revenue growth on a constant currency basis and non-GAAP organic recurring revenue growth, in analyzing its operating performance. Blackbaud believes that these non-GAAP measures are useful to investors, as a supplement to GAAP measures, for evaluating the periodic growth of its business on a consistent basis. Each of these measures excludes incremental acquisition-related revenue attributable to companies acquired in the current fiscal year. For companies acquired in the immediately preceding fiscal year, each of these measures reflects presentation of full-year incremental non-GAAP revenue derived from such companies as if they were combined throughout the prior period, and it includes the non-GAAP revenue attributable to those companies, as if there were no acquisition-related write-downs of acquired deferred revenue to fair value as required by GAAP. In addition, each of these measures excludes prior period revenue associated with divested businesses. The exclusion of the prior period revenue is to present the results of the divested businesses within the results of the combined company for the same period of time in both the prior and current periods. Blackbaud believes this presentation provides a more comparable representation of its current business' organic revenue growth and revenue run-rate.

Non-GAAP free cash flow is defined as operating cash flow less capital expenditures, including costs required to be capitalized for software development, and capital expenditures for property and equipment.
